Nigeria's National Agricultural Research Service (NAERLs) has allowed an 80% crop loss in 2022 due to natural disasters and pests. Representatives of the department attributed rice, sorghum and millet to the most affected crops. The cost of these cereals in the country has already increased by 1.5 times. In addition, specialists NAERLs acute shortage of fertilizers. They referred to the statements of the owners of large chain stores of agricultural products.
